UN Seeks $21.9bln in Aid Next Year, Largest Needs in Yemen

The United Nations appealed for $21.9 billion on Tuesday to address 21 humanitarian crises worldwide next year, including $4 billion for Yemen, its largest aid operation. 13 People Killed, Injured in Fresh Saudi Airstrikes on Yemen’s Sa’ada

At least 13 people, including women and children, were killed and injured when Saudi warplanes targeted an area of Yemen’s northern province of Sa’ada. According to Yemen’s Saba news agency, the Saudi aerial aggression targeted residential areas in the Kataf district on Monday, killing four and injuring nine civilians there. Senate Advances Bill to End US Involvement in Saudi-Led War on Yemen

The US Senate delivered a strong bipartisan rebuke to President Donald Trump’s policy on Saudi Arabia by overwhelmingly voting to advance a resolution that would end all Washington’s involvement in the Saudi-led war in Yemen.
